All In the process of looking through screened material from the Upper Paleocene Bells Landing Member of the Tuscahoma Formation, I came across this small 3 mm shark tooth. This deposit located within Monroe County, Alabama is equivalent in age to the Paspotansa Member of the Aquia Formation in Virginia. I searched the Aquia section on Elasmo.com but could not find anything similar. I don't know if this is a juvenile or an adult tooth but the most noticeable feature is the deep nutrient groove. I am hoping one of the many shark tooth experts here on the forum might be able to give some insight into what it is. Left: Lingual Right: Labial. Thanks Mike

Striatolamia Macrota with Pathologic Deformities found at Purse State Park MD
Gneave posted a topic in Fossil Hunting Trips
Before quarantine took effect, I had a chance to visit Purse State park. I normally frequent Brownie Beach, but the recent cliff collapse forced me to try some other spots. I was also interested in finding some much older fossils from the Paleocene formations along the Potomac. I found tons of turritella gastropod molds, and many smaller lamnid teeth. Some of the larger ones I found were pretty easy to identify as Striatolamia species, most likely S. macrota that had slight surface wear from being washed around in the Potomac. Most teeth from this location seem to be similarly eroded, and almost all my S. macrota specimens seem to be missing their telltale crown striations. I found some nice looking ones I found, all approximately an inch in length and with a hint of blue coloring. Towards the end of the trip I also stumbled upon a likely pathological lateral tooth, probably another Striatolamia. It definitely caught my eye, and I really liked the weird curvature of the crown. This one was about half an inch in length, and although it might not be easy to tell from the photo, it had a much stubbier tip that was not the result of chipping or erosion. Help request! I am putting together a tool for judging rock age based on very crude, whole-rock, hand-sample observations of fossil faunas/floras -- the types of observations a child or beginner could successfully make. I view this as a complement to the very fine, species-level identifications commonly employed as index fossils for individual stages, biozones, etc. Attached is what I've got so far, but I can clearly use help with corals, mollusks, plants, vertebrates, ichnofossils, and the post-Paleozoic In the attached file, vibrant orange indicates times in earth history to commonly observe the item of interest; paler orange indicates times in earth history to less commonly observe the item of interest. White indicates very little to no practical probability of observing the item of interest. Please keep in mind that the listed indicators are things like “conspicuous horn corals,” purposefully declining to address rare encounters with groups of low preservation potential, low recognizability, etc. Got additions/amendments, especially for the groups mentioned above?
